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Several things affect the quality of your photos.

  • Lighting: Good lighting is very important. Bright light helps the camera take better pictures. Dark places can make pictures blurry.
  • Sensor Size: A bigger sensor captures more light. This leads to better pictures.
  • Image Stabilization: This helps reduce blur. It is especially helpful if you are moving.
  • Build Quality: A well-made camera will last longer. Look for cameras that feel sturdy.
  • Software: The camera’s software can improve the picture. Good software can fix common problems.
